Bulletin Summary
McNeilus Truck and Manufacturing, Inc. states that making any changes to the eZR Low Voltage (LV) wiring system on Battery Electric Vehicle (BEV) units have been shown to, in some instances, affect the ability of the system to properly charge. Typically, BEV systems rely on a complete sleep mode during charging; therefore, any changes that affect the ignition key-off state of the vehicle have been shown especially likely to impact the charging procedure.
About Technical Service Bulletins
A Technical Service Bulletin (TSB) is a document issued by a vehicle manufacturer to its dealers, describing a known issue with a specific vehicle or set of vehicles and the recommended procedure to fix it. Unlike recalls, TSBs are not mandatory and are typically only performed if an owner reports the related issue. However, TSBs can be an indicator of common problems with a vehicle.
